Transaction 5637beb40f139beb82d936da6f873e480a916b23bced047ecd98ff7deb8b00e7

1 Input
2 Outputs
  • 5637beb40f139beb82d936da6f873e480a916b23bced047ecd98ff7deb8b00e7:0
  • value  29505275
    address  33CZ8AC6AUKzRzy7azQtbUkWEEp4LeSycJ
  • 5637beb40f139beb82d936da6f873e480a916b23bced047ecd98ff7deb8b00e7:1
  • value  714910
    address  324E6psyuSyoHSAhfBk5wf1kt6uoyMayWw